PCSX2 SVN Changelog:
r5157
copyright: soundtouch was LGPL2.1 not LGPL2.1+, add an header to launch_pcsx2_linux.sh
cmake: keep all library for the linking of plugins
hex2h.pl: add svn:executable
r5158
Small fix to mVU. Doesn't seem to help any game though.
r5159
cmake:
* build the utility to prebuilt cg shader (zzogl-shader)
* build the shader (ps2hw_cmake.dat) that would avoid copyright issue for debian/ubuntu
r5160
Change various logs to sound "nicer".
r5161
copyright again:
* add some missing copyright header
* (l)GPLv* requires to have a full copy of the license. We already have them in various sub-directory but files in source root are easier to find
